But he was never inspired to categorize his collection into specific themes or productions. "I like it being this crazy mix." Muppets and Star Wars characters mingle with Mayor McCheese and the Stay Puft Marshmallow Man. right: In 4th grade, Balistreri traveled to Austria and discovered Asterix, Lucky Luke and the pantheon of Belgian comics artists. "The influence of that artwork always stuck with me," he says. "André Franquin is my art God!" A small drawing by the artist holds a place of honor above his desk. above: "The Indy is my dream pinball machine," he says. It gives him an excuse to get up from his desk and take a break from work. "I got them for health reasons," he says with a laugh. left: Mr. Toad presents Animal, who wears all of Balistreri's "heavy metal merch." "I surround myself with as much stuff as possible," he says laughing. "More is more." During the week, Balistreri works at Disney TV as an Executive Producer on Tangled. But during evenings and on the weekend, he retreats to this creative kingdom where he works surrounded by collections amassed over decades.
